Tips for Urban Survival in the Event of a Peaceful Protest Turning into a Riot

When faced with a protest that transforms into a riot, it’s essential to have a plan and take necessary precautions to safeguard yourself. Here are some tips to consider:

  1. Stay Informed: Prior to attending any protest, stay informed about the event by researching the organizers, the purpose, and potential risks. Understand the tone and context of the protest to be fully aware of the possible outcomes.

  2. Dress Appropriately: Dress in layers and wear clothing that covers your body adequately. Opt for comfortable and sturdy footwear to ensure mobility. Avoid wearing anything that might identify your political affiliations or attract unwanted attention.

  3. Maintain Situational Awareness: Continuously observe your surroundings, paying particular attention to any signs of escalation or potential danger. Be aware of escape routes and safe locations nearby.

  4. Stay Calm: In a volatile situation, it’s crucial to remain calm and composed. Panic can cloud your judgment and impair your ability to react effectively. Focus on your personal safety and the safety of those around you.

  5. Avoid the Crowd: If you notice the protest turning violent or chaotic, consider reducing your proximity to the main crowd. Retreating to a safer location can help you avoid potential harm.

  1. Can I bring self-defense tools to a protest?

It is important to check local regulations and laws regarding the carrying of self-defense tools during protests. In some circumstances, these tools may be prohibited, while in others, non-lethal options such as pepper spray and personal alarms may be allowed.

  1. How can I document incidents during a protest safely?

When documenting incidents during a protest, ensure your personal safety is not compromised. Utilize your smartphone to capture photos or videos discreetly, without drawing attention to yourself.
